A loose-fitting dolman cape in tan wool featuring extensive decorative fringe trim. The garment displays the characteristic wide, bat-wing sleeves that taper toward the wrists, creating a dramatic silhouette when worn. Heavy golden fringe adorns the front opening edges, sleeve cuffs, and hemline, adding substantial weight and movement to the piece. The cape fastens at the neck with what appears to be a hook closure. This style exemplifies the Victorian preference for elaborate outerwear that could accommodate the large bustled silhouettes underneath while providing warmth and fashionable coverage for formal occasions.
